How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Ross?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Ross Studio Apartments | $1,975 | $1,975 | $1,975 |
| Ross 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,850 | $2,315 | $3,739 |
| Ross 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,574 | $2,750 | $4,695 |
| Ross 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,345 | $5,345 | $5,345 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Ross
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Ross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Ross ranges from $2,315 to $3,739 with an average monthly rent of $2,850.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Ross c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Ross range from $2,750 to $4,695.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,574.
